Preparation And Properties Characterization Of Silicon-containing Oxide Continuous Fibers

With the rapid development of materials science and technology,the sol-gel method for fabricating oxide continuous fibers has been widely employed.The sol-gel method is a wet chemical method with the advantages of the low temperature of fabrication process,high chemical composition uniformity,high product purity,and so on.Al2O3-SiO2 composite continuous ceramic fibers and SiO2 continuous fibers were performed by sol-gel method,and the preparation of spinnable precursor sol,the spinning process,gel fiber ceramization,ceramic fiber microstructure and the mechanical properties of the fiber were studied in detail.Oxide continuous fibers have been widely applied in various fields like aerospace,due to its unique properties.However,domestic research on oxide fibers is still in very initial stage,and there is still a large gap in product performance compared with other countries.Therefore,the research and preparation of oxide continuous fibers is urgent and of great importance.1.Preparation and characterization of Al2O3-SiO2 ceramic continuous fibersIn this experiment,the aluminium-containing sol was prepared through two different methods.One is prepared using the aluminum hydroxide suspension arising from the reaction of inorganic aluminium salt solution and alkali solution as an aluminium source,followed by addition of a certain proportion of acetic acid to prepare the spinnable aluminium carboxylate sol.The other is the Al13 sol prepared by adding aluminium chloride hexahydrate solution.After mixing with silica sol or spinning auxiliaries,the spinnable sol possessing suitable viscosity was obtained when the solution was evaporated,then,the gel fibers were obtained by dry spinning technology.After pyrolysis in air,two kinds of alumina-silica composite continuous ceramic fibers were obtained.They were characterized by TG-DSC-MS,XRD,FT-IR,TEM and SEM,and so on.The effects of properties of fabricated ceramic fibers resulted from the precursor sol were systematically researched.The results show that the spinnability of aluminium carboxylate sol comes from the formation of aluminium dimer or trimer and aluminium polymer.The spinnability of Al13 sol comes from the condensation of Al13 particles.During the ceramization process,the compact ceramic continuous fibers can be obtained by using slow heating rate and long holding time at the low temperature,and by performing fastly heating rate and short holding time at high sintering temperature.2.Preparation and characterization of SiO2 continuous fibersIn the present work,the precursor sol was firstly prepared using tetraethyl orthosilicate as the silicon source,ethanol as the solvent,nitric acid as the catalyst,and ethyl cellulose as the spinning auxiliaries.The combined mixture was stirred and concentrated,the spinnable sol possessing the proper viscosity was obtained,followed by dry spinning and pyrolysis technology at high temperature to form continuous silica fibers,successively.The precursor sol and ceramization process how to affect the fiber properties were respectively studied by TG-DSC,XRD.FT-IR,SEM,and so on.The results indicate that the hydrolysis process can be dominated by alcohol polymerization by controlling the ratios of water combined with silicon and the ratios of acid combined with silicon.Both the gelation time of the sol can be prolonged and the stability of the sol can be obviously improved by addition of ethyl cellulose.It provides a new thought about fabricating silica fibers at low temperature.When the water/silicon ratio is about 2.0 and the ratio of acid/silicon is about 0.03,the sol shows long-term stability along with with good spinnability to form fine gel fibers.The SiO2 fiber prepared by the sol-gel method has a diameter of about 8.6 μm and a maximum tensile strength of 0.88 GPa.
